I used to buy shoes that I felt were “safe”. This usually meant sticking to “safe” colors like black, white, navy blue. Consequently, I ended up having a pretty plain wardrobe. Sometimes you see items on the rack or in a magazine that you could never picture yourself wearing. It’s those pieces that you end up buying and getting compliments on because they’re breaking the rules of fashion.
The shoes, as the rest of your clothing, should be interesting. Look for colors, a mix of patterns or material (say suede + leather) and interesting details. Right now, take a minute or two to study a photo of an interesting pair of shoes and see how many details you can list (even the sole is special!). Now, that’s what makes a piece of clothing interesting.
